The Chicago Bears are listing Jay Cutler as doubtful to play in Week 7 vs. the Green Bay Packers. To no surprise, Cutler will miss another game due to his sprained thumb sustained in Week 2.
However, Chicago may simply be holding Cutler out longer than is needed because of how well Brian Hoyer has played in relief. Hoyer has been solid in recent weeks and made this team at least competitive, something Cutler was unable to do in his two games as a starter.
Hoyer has thrown for 1,318 yards and six scores while taking just four sacks in his four starts. As for Cutler, he has thrown for just 373 yards and one touchdown vs. two interceptions and eight sacks taken in two games of work.
